WHAT is the first thing you do while you land a multimillion-ringgit investment round? Hire extra engineers, support advertising, plan a main A&P marketing campaign, purchase greater device to ramp up production? Or stay focused on the end aim and use the funding to get there?
For Dr Gabriel Walter (percent, left), leader govt officer of high speed LED begin-up Quantum Electro Opto Systems Sdn Bhd (QEOS), the focus is squarely on its purpose of becoming an acquisition goal.
As he factors out, “Nobody buys you due to the fact your organisation has a brilliant advertising and marketing group, quality manipulate or logistics talents. They buy you due to your technology,” due to the fact that larger corporations could already have these types of components in location.
“My goal is to build our valuation up to US$100 million by means of the stop of 2013, that is 3-fold what it is these days,” he says while requested what his important intention is now that he has acquired RM10 million (US$three.five million) in undertaking investment from Agensi Inovasi Malaysia (AIM).
AIM is a statutory frame set up by the Malaysian Government to gas the push toward setting up an ‘innovation economy.’
The injection is simply the modern day in a chain of investment that QEOS has received over time and it is the maiden funding task by AIM, the national innovation employer hooked up in 2010.
“It is good to growth manufacturing and get revenue but that is not the maximum critical component for us given our strategy – valuation is prime,” says Walter.
The important consciousness is to maintain growing its price by means of adding extra patents and variations of technology and merchandise. It has additionally commenced operating with semiconductor fab Silterra in Kulim to come up with a few key components based totally on Silterra’s platform.
More importantly, the modern round offers Walter greater respiratory area and a feel of continuation with a -year time frame.
“I can now plan for the long term whereas earlier than you're usually focused at the want to tempo yourself and make certain you spend money well,” he says. “You realize, while you are continually saving, that restricts the kind of activities you may do, so this funding injection is just a large load off my thoughts.”
Not your typical Malaysian start-up
QEOS itself stands proud from maximum other begin-u.s.a.of recent years in Malaysia, absolutely because it's far in a space where it has a completely unique patent-protected optical laser technology.
And, in the direction of the goal of maximizing its cost, as opposed to just licensing the generation as a issue piece in a system, QEOS is constructing the whole product, in this case the high-speed optical cables to be used in information centers, supercomputing and customer electronics along with the now ubiquitous HDMI cables lying around in most households.
“Moving up the meals chain,” is how Dr Raymond Chin (percent. Proper) describes it. Silicon Valley-based Chin is the chairman of QEOS and answerable for enhance product improvement and business development.
It is uncommon for a boss to also helm product and enterprise development, but Chin’s role is reflective of the approach of QEOS to be an acquisition goal.
He describes his function as “mapping what we've got and our technology trajectory to attempt to get some thing into the marketplace that addresses the wishes of some of the top technology companies and in the shortest time frame.”
Those pinnacle generation groups are certainly based totally inside the United States and in Silicon Valley mainly – which is wherein Chin has his network and home.
Chin himself isn't your common chairman of the common Malaysian begin-up. Over the past 25 years, he has led more than one entrepreneurial younger corporations, as chairman or CEO, in addition to making an investment while serving as a venture capital associate in corporate and private project corporations.
In the early 1990s he turned into performing CEO of Proxim Inc, wherein he repositioned the employer from a wireless inventory radio tag provider to an innovator and pioneer within the wi-fi LAN (nearby place network) marketplace.
Within 3 years of this strategic change, the business enterprise had a a success public listing on NASDAQ. He additionally holds 3 patents inside the areas of wi-fi networks and multi-quantum layer image detectors.
But that pales in contrast to the 8 granted patents Walter has, with 38 more pending! Some of the patents revolve around his position in 2004 as co-inventor of the arena’s first transistor laser, making feasible new possibilities in high-speed optoelectronics and incorporated circuits.
Besides his patents, Walter’s paintings has resulted in extra than forty nine peer-reviewed magazine papers and 12 convention papers. Clearly the Sarawak-born researcher is not your average academician grew to become entrepreneur.
QEOS was founded in 2008 with the aid of Walter and two different researchers from the University of Illinois Urbana-Champaign and hooked up its base in Melaka whilst it obtained a Ministry of Science, Technology and Innovation (Mosti) Brain Gain Malaysia Diaspora provide of RM2.8 million.
